Netspend overdraft $200.

Netspend has an optional overdraft protection policy for cardholders who get at least one direct deposit of $200 or higher every 30 days. You’ll get a 24-hour grace period to evade fees. After that, you’ll get charged $15 unless you overdraft your account by less than $10. If you overspend a little, Netspend may waive your overdraft fee.

Overdraft fee: $15; Out-of-network ATM fee: $3; Foreign transaction fee: 3%; Netspend offers prepaid debit card users overdraft protection when their account balance goes under -$10.01. Customers must enroll and have at least one direct deposit of $200 or more every 30 days. Netspend charges $15 per overdraft transaction up to a maximum of three transactions each month.

When you first become eligible for SpotMe, you'll be able to overdraw your account by up to $20. Your limit may increase up to $200 over time depending on the history of any Chime-branded accounts you have, the frequency and amount of direct deposits, your spending activity, and other risk factors.
